The 100 biggest Serie A fan bases in Brazil

This curated ranking covers the 100 largest serie a teams in Brazil, ordered by estimated audience size from Rascasse's anonymized search-behavior signals. Out of 538 serie a teams tracked in Brazil, the 100 ranked here account for the largest measured audience reach. Juventus F.C., A.C. Milan and Inter Milan lead the list with a combined estimated audience of 15M people. Across all 100 entries the average audience size is 415k, and the largest, Juventus F.C., reaches around 6.9M people in Brazil. Audience size is the estimated number of unique people in Brazil who actively engage with each serie a team, derived from search demand signals. Rankings reflect search-behavior signals collected across Brazil and are refreshed weekly.
